Federal Judge Orders Pretrial Detention of Man Accused of Threatening Richard Grenell

A federal judge in Alexandria, Virginia ordered the pretrial detention of 33-year-old Scott Allen Bolger, who faces charges of threatening to kill Richard Grenell and making false statements to federal officers.

Grenell, identified by the Department of Justice (DOJ) as the target, is the Kennedy Center president, a former U.S. ambassador to Germany, and a longtime ally of former President Donald Trump.

According to the DOJ, Bolger allegedly used Google Voice to send interstate threats and misled a federal task force by claiming to be named "Brian Black."

Bolger was arraigned in federal court in Alexandria, where U.S. Magistrate Judge William Fitzpatrick issued the detention order. The DOJ noted that such decisions for pretrial detention can be rare.

If convicted, Bolger could face up to five years in prison.

The DOJ described the detention as a win for the department and for Acting U.S. Attorney Lindsey Halligan for the Eastern District of Virginia, who attended the arraignment but did not play a formal role.

In court, a victim statement from Grenell was read, in which he described the threats as crossing a line and emphasized the seriousness of violence, referencing the death of Charlie Kirk.

Grenell was not present in court but was identified as a federal employee in a press release.

This case reflects broader concerns about threats and intimidation targeting high-profile public figures amid ongoing political tensions.
